Injustice Watch also found the private vendor with the exclusive contract to provide the alcohol-monitoring device, as well as a drug-testing patch to Cook County probationers, CAM Systems, has been operating without a contract for more than two years a matter currently under review by the Cook County auditor. Nienhouse said the company was prepared to lower her fee if she provided proof of her changed financial circumstances, such as a termination notice from work or unemployment paperwork but said they never received it. Some people in Cook County described chafing and blisters on their skin from wearing SCRAM bracelets, even though the company that supplies the device locally provides periodic maintenance to make sure that the bracelet fits correctly and its metal receiver is clean.
